Skip to content

Commit 374a43e

Browse files
committed
wrap file symbol for frontend
1 parent 6b2779a commit 374a43e

File tree

3 files changed

+16
-7
lines changed

3 files changed

+16
-7
lines changed

client/browser/FinderFileSelect.tsx

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-168,7 +168,9 @@ export default function FinderFileSelect(props) {
168168
<slot ref={slotRef} />
169169
<div className="finder-file-select">
170170
<figure>{selectedFile ? <>
171-
<img src={selectedFile.thumbnail_url} onClick={openDialog} onDragEnter={openDialog} />
171+
<div>
172+
<img src={selectedFile.thumbnail_url} onClick={openDialog} onDragEnter={openDialog} />
173+
</div>
172174
<figcaption>
173175
<dl>
174176
<dt>{gettext("Name")}:</dt>
@@ -189,9 +191,9 @@ export default function FinderFileSelect(props) {
189191
<button className="remove-file-button" type="button" onClick={removeFile}>{gettext("Remove")}</button>
190192
</figcaption>
191193
</> :
192-
<span onClick={openDialog} onDragEnter={openDialog}>
194+
<div onClick={openDialog} onDragEnter={openDialog}>
193195
<p>{gettext("Select File")}</p>
194-
</span>
196+
</div>
195197
}</figure>
196198
</div>
197199
<dialog ref={dialogRef}>

client/browser/FinderFolderSelect.tsx

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-147,7 +147,9 @@ export default function FinderFolderSelect(props) {
147147
<slot ref={slotRef} />
148148
<div className="finder-file-select">
149149
<figure>{selectedFolder ? <>
150-
<img src={folderIconUrl} onClick={openDialog} onDragEnter={openDialog} />
150+
<div>
151+
<img src={folderIconUrl} onClick={openDialog} onDragEnter={openDialog} />
152+
</div>
151153
<figcaption>
152154
<dl>
153155
<dt>{gettext("Name")}:</dt>
@@ -164,9 +166,9 @@ export default function FinderFolderSelect(props) {
164166
<button className="remove-file-button" type="button" onClick={removeFolder}>{gettext("Remove")}</button>
165167
</figcaption>
166168
</> :
167-
<span onClick={openDialog} onDragEnter={openDialog}>
169+
<div onClick={openDialog} onDragEnter={openDialog}>
168170
<p>{gettext("Select Folder")}</p>
169-
</span>
171+
</div>
170172
}</figure>
171173
</div>
172174
<dialog ref={dialogRef}>

client/scss/finder-browser.scss

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@
1313
padding: 0;
1414
outline: gray thin dotted;
1515

16-
>img, >span {
16+
>div {
1717
width: 180px;
1818
height: 180px;
1919
border-radius: 0.125rem;
@@ -25,6 +25,11 @@
2525
&:hover {
2626
cursor: pointer;
2727
}
28+
29+
img[src$=".svg"] {
30+
width: 80%;
31+
height: 80%;
32+
}
2833
}
2934

3035
>figcaption {

0 commit comments

Comments
 (0)